RESUSCITATION MASKS OR DEVICES Mouthpieces, resuscitation bags, pocket masks and/or ventilation bags are readily available foremergency situation and/or CPR training.Location of resuscitation device(s): ________________________ _______________________E. OTHER PROTECTIVE CLOTHING/DEVICES Additional protective wear is worn, as appropriate, for <strong>the</strong> task being performed. Situations whichwould require such protection (e.g., gloves, masks) are as follows:______________________ ______________________ _______________________F. DISPOSAL, STORAGE, CLEANING AND LAUNDERING Personal protective equipment (e.g., gloves, masks) is disposed of as follows:______________________ ______________________ _______________________(List appropriate containers for disposal) Reusable personal protective equipment (e.g., goggles, face shields, resuscitation masks or devices) arecleaned as follows: Gowns/lab coats are stored before laundering in appropriately labeled/color-coded containers andlaundered by: Gowns/lab coats are laundered at NO COST to employees. All repairs and replacements of personal protective equipment are made atNO COST to employees (e.g., gloves, masks).<strong>OSHA</strong> EXPOSURE CONTROL PLAN…a member benefit from <strong>the</strong> WDA 18
